2013-02-08 79 views
0

我想選擇br之後沒有跟着的另一個brCSS選擇br後面跟着br

例如。

<br>sometext<br>adsf 

我想選擇這兩個元素。

<br><br>sometext<br><br>adsf 

我只需要選擇2 br元素,不是4

我已經看到了這個問題,但我不明白它是如何工作的。

CSS select element which does not follow element

+1

爲什麼要選擇'
'標記?你無法對他們做任何事情。 – 2013-02-08 14:23:05

+2

':not(br)+ br'會做到這一點。從另一個問題的例子中可以看出這一點嗎? – Jon 2013-02-08 14:23:08

+0

[CSS select元素不遵循元素]的可能重複(http://stackoverflow.com/questions/13212909/css-select-element-which-does-not-follow-element) – Jon 2013-02-08 14:23:49

回答

1

使用兩個選擇,一是增加了一個風格所有br標籤和其中一個去除了風格br+br

br { /* add the style */ } 
br+br { /* take it away again, or change it to 'inherit' */ }